Centar Župa weather in November

In November, Centar Župa sees average daytime highs of 9°C and overnight lows near 1°C, with 121 mm of precipitation across 10.9 wet days and about 9.7 hours of daylight. It is the 8th-warmest and 2nd-wettest month of the year here.

Highs ease over the month, from about 12°C in the first days to 7°C by the end. The sky is clear or mostly clear about 30% of the time in November, and the air most often feels dry.

Daylight stretches from about 10 h 12 min at the start of November to 9 h 12 min by month's end. Set against the rest of the year, November is Centar Župa's 8th-clearest and 7th-windiest month. For the whole year in context, see Centar Župa's year-round climate.

Temperature in November

Average highAverage lowShaded bands: 10–90% of days

Highs ease over the month, from about 12°C in the first days to 7°C by the end.

A typical November day in Centar Župa reaches about 9°C in the afternoon and slips back to 1°C overnight — a 9°C spread between the day's warmth and the night's chill. On most days the high lands between 4°C and 14°C. Set against its neighbours, November runs about 6°C cooler than October and about 6°C warmer than December.

Chance of precipitation in November

Any precipitationSnow

Centar Župa gets around 121 mm of rain and snow over 10.9 wet days in November. The line is the day-by-day chance of measurable precipitation.

Day to day, the chance of measurable precipitation averages around 36% and peaks near 42% on the wettest days, and about 3 days bring snow. The odds climb toward the end of the month.

Sunrise & sunset in November

DaylightNight

Daylight runs from about 10 h 12 min at the start of November to 9 h 12 min by month's end. The lit band spans sunrise to sunset each day.

Days shrink by about 60 minutes over November. Sunrise moves from 6:16 AM to 6:50 AM, and sunset from 4:27 PM to 4:04 PM.

Location & terrain

Where is Centar Župa?

Centar Župa sits at 41.5°N, 20.6°E, 738 m above sea level, in North Macedonia. The nearest listed city is Debar, 6.0 km away.

Topography around Centar Župa

How much the land rises and falls, and what covers it, within 3, 16 and 80 km of Centar Župa.

Within 3 km, the terrain around Centar Župa has large vari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 969 m around an average of 823 m above sea level; within 16 km, very significant vari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 1,890 m; within 80 km, extreme vari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 2,708 m.

The land around Centar Župa is covered by trees (55%) and grassland (29%) within 3 km, trees (60%) and grassland (33%) within 16 km, and trees (59%) and grassland (29%) within 80 km.

Data sources

Temperature, precipitation, cloud, humidity, wind and solar figures are a 1991–2020 climatology for Centar Župa (41.4785°, 20.5594°, elevation 738 m), computed from hourly ERA5 reanalysis — contains modified Copernicus Climate Change Service information. Sun figures are astronomical calculations, not observations. City data © GeoNames, CC BY 4.0. Map outlines from Natural Earth (public domain); interactive map © Google. UV index is derived from CAMS (Copernicus Atmosphere Monitoring Service) clear-sky UV data — contains modified Copernicus Atmosphere Monitoring Service information. Topography is sampled from the Copernicus DEM GLO-90 elevation model (© ESA/Airbus) and ESA WorldCover 2021 land cover (CC BY 4.0).
